About the Team

The Avionics team is responsible for the full lifecycle of Terran R’s nervous system, designing, building, testing, installing, and operating the hardware that connects and controls every major electrical system on the vehicle and ground. The team’s structure intentionally combines avionics design, manufacturing, and test to enable rapid iteration and feedback loops. Engineers are deeply embedded into other functions within Relativity, working closely with propulsion, GNC, fluids, and stage engineering teams to ensure seamless integration and operation. Responsibilities
  • Directly manage and support avionics PCBA rework technician team and the SMT line. Support technician training, certification, and development.
  • Drive daily production execution, quality assurance, and schedule adherence.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Supply Chain, Production Control, and Logistics to ensure material readiness and timely issue resolution.
  • Identify and implement tools, floor layouts, and capital equipment to improve build efficiency and technician ergonomics.
  • Establish and track key production metrics (e.g., throughput, cycle time, first-pass yield).
  • Foster a culture of safety, accountability, and continuous improvement.
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ree in engineering, manufacturing, or a related field, or equivalent practical experience.
  • 3+ years of experience in a production leadership role in aerospace, electronics, or a high-reliability manufacturing environment.
  • Direct experience managing or supporting teams building and/or reworking PCBAs and building electro-mechanical assemblies.
  • Strong organizational and problem‑solving skills with a focus on execution.
  • Proven ability to collaborate across departments in a fast‑paced environment.
  • Strong computer and analytical skills including proficiency in spreadsheets, databases, shop floor management software (ERP/MRP/MES) or related programs and dashboards.
Nice to have but not required
  • Experience with avionics or aerospace manufacturing standards (e.g., IPC‑A‑610, IPC/WHMA‑A‑620, NASA‑STD‑8739).
  • Hands‑on experience developing or optimizing manufacturing workstations, tooling, and layouts.
  • Experience with ERP and MES systems for production management.
  • Familiarity with Lean Manufacturing, Six Sigma, or similar methodologies.
  • Strong technical background in electronics or harness design, build, or test.
